引言

在区块链和去中心化金融(DeFi)生态中,数字货币用户经常需要与智能合约进行交互。有时候,为了保护资产安全,用户可能需要解除与某些智能合约的授权。在这一背景下,tpWallet作为一种流行的钱包工具,提供了简单而高效的方式来管理合约授权。但许多用户对如何解除授权仍有疑问,在本文中,我们将详细探讨tpWallet怎么解除授权的合约,并提供相关注意事项。

什么是智能合约授权

智能合约授权是指用户通过钱包向智能合约授予了一定的权限,使其可以对账户中的数字资产进行操作。这种授权机制是区块链中一种常见的安全措施,确保只有在用户允许的情况下,智能合约才能对其资产进行管理和操作。

例如,当你使用某个DeFi协议进行交易或借贷时,你通常需要先授权该协议访问你的代币资产。这确保了在你明确同意的情况下,协议才能进行代币转移。然而,有时候由于合约可能存在安全漏洞或为了进一步保护资产,用户可能决定解除这些授权。

tpWallet概述

tpWallet是一款支持多种链的数字钱包,因其易于使用、高度安全以及对智能合约的良好支持而受到广泛欢迎。tpWallet不仅支持简单的收发功能,还允许用户与多种DeFi协议进行交互,为用户提供了丰富的链上操作功能。了解如何使用tpWallet解除合约的授权,是每位用户保护自己资产的重要技能。

解除授权的必要性

解除授权合约的必要性主要在于防范风险。随着DeFi生态的日益复杂,用户授权的合约数量可能逐渐增多。某些合约可能在用户不知情的情况下存在安全漏洞,而一旦授权,如果不及时取消,可能会导致资产损失。

此外,用户可能在不再使用某些服务后也希望撤销授权,以降低资金被盗用的风险。定期审查并解除不再需要的合约授权是保护资产的好习惯。

tpWallet解除授权的步骤

下面是使用tpWallet解除授权合约的详细步骤:

  1. 打开tpWallet应用,输入密码或使用生物识别身份验证进入钱包。
  2. 在钱包首页,选择“资产”选项,查看当前持有的代币。
  3. 找到你想解除授权的代币,点击进入详情页面。
  4. 在代币详情页面,找到“授权管理”或“解除授权”选项,点击进入。
  5. 在解除授权页面,选择你希望解除授权的合约。通常会列出所有曾经授权的合约。
  6. 点击“解除授权”按钮,并在弹出的确认框中确认你的选择。
  7. 再核实交易信息后,确认交易,完成解除授权的操作。
  8. 在解除授权后,查看钱包的交易记录,以确保操作成功。

解除合约授权的注意事项

在进行授权解除之前,用户需要注意以下几点:

  • 了解合约性质:在解除授权之前,确认该合约是否是你正在使用的DeFi协议或应用,避免误操作。
  • 确认资产安全:在解除授权后,务必确保不会影响你正在进行的交易或借贷活动。
  • 备份钱包信息:在进行任何重要操作之前,确保你的钱包信息已备份,以防止意外情况导致资产损失。
  • 查看交易费用:解除授权同样会产生交易费用,确保你在操作时有足够的手续费余额。
  • 反复确认:在确认操作之前,务必反复检查合约地址及交易信息,确保无误。

常见问题

1. 为什么要解除授权的合约?

解除授权合约是保护数字资产安全的重要措施。用户授权的合约在操作中可能存在一定的风险,包括安全漏洞、合约行为不当或者不再需要这些合约的服务等。当用户不再需要与某个合约交互时,解除授权可以有效减少资金被盗用或误操作的风险。尤其是在DeFi领域,用户常常与多个合约交互,及时审查并解除不必要的授权是至关重要的。

例如,某个用户可能授权了一个借贷平台的合约用于质押贷款,但在归还贷款后很少再使用这个平台,继续保留授权可能导致不必要的风险。通过解除不再需要的合约授权,用户可以更好地控制自己的资产,确保安全。

2. tpWallet会不会影响其他钱包的授权?

tpWallet中的合约授权与其他钱包之间是相互独立的。解除tpWallet中的合约授权不会影响其他钱包(如MetaMask、Trust Wallet等)中相同合约的授权状态。如果你在tpWallet解除了一些合约的授权,这仅仅是针对tpWallet内部的操作。对于在其他钱包中进行的操作,用户需要单独进行授权管理。

需要注意的是,若在多个钱包中同时与同一个合约交互,建议定期检查每个钱包的授权状态,以确保更全面的安全管理。这可以帮助用户了解自己所有授权过的合约,从而及时作出决策以保护资产安全。

3. 解除合约授权后还能恢复吗?

解除合约授权后,用户可以再次授权该合约来恢复操作权限。解除授权只是撤回之前授予的权限,用户随时可以选择重新授权。重新授权的过程与首次授权相似,用户需要再次确认合约地址,并批准合约访问相关资产。

不过,用户在重新授权时,需要再次支付网络手续费,因此在经济性上要有所考虑。此外,应当确保在重新授权之前,合约本身是否可信,以免重复暴露资产于风险之中。时刻保持警惕,只有在了解并信任合约的情况下,再考虑给予其授权,这才是智慧用户的选择。

4. 解除授权的风险有哪些?

解除合约授权本身不是一项高风险操作,但在某些情况下可能会面临一些不便和潜在风险。首先,如果用户误解除某个正在使用的合约的授权,可能会导致贷款、质押、交易等操作失败,给用户带来麻烦。

其次,一些合约的功能和操作是相互依赖的,解除某个合约的授权可能会影响到其他正在进行的活动。比如,一个农场合约可能依赖于多个授权的合约,如果其中一个被解除,整个收益流程可能受到影响。

此外,解除授权后需要重新授权的操作也会耗费时间和手续费。如果频繁解除再授权,可能给用户带来额外的财务负担和操作麻烦。用户在解除授权时,建议结合自己的使用情况进行综合考虑,避免不必要的风险和麻烦。

5. 如何查看当前的合约授权情况?

要查看当前的合约授权情况,用户可以通过tpWallet内的“授权管理”功能进行查询。通常该部分会列出所有已经授权的合约,并且提供相关操作按钮,如解除授权、查看合约详情等。通过这一功能,用户可以全面了解自己的授权情况,方便管理。

此外,用户也可以借助一些区块链浏览器通过输入地址来查询相关合约的状态。不少区块链浏览器支持查询合约的授权情况及与某个地址的交互记录,为用户提供透明的信息来源。了解授权情况后,用户可以及时做出必要的反应,以便保护自己的资产安全。

总结

综上所述,解除tpWallet中的合约授权是一个保障资产安全的重要过程。通过本文详细的步骤和注意事项,相信用户能够更加清楚地管理自己的合约授权,避免潜在的资金风险。无论是在使用DeFi协议时,还是在日常管理数字资产,定期审查,并适时解除不需要的授权都将是每个用户保护财产的重要习惯。希望大家都能在数字货币的世界中,安全且高效地管理自己的资产。